Output 570ebdb49c68bf45b759d3802e08c67f2033ea80dcf712b47ed4e970c75fc614:0

value
2835568
script pubkey
OP_0 OP_PUSHBYTES_20 3d8b7aed726953b82b55538bdc581d436518a996
address
bc1q8k9h4mtjd9fms2642w9ackqagdj332vkaa9a8a
transaction
570ebdb49c68bf45b759d3802e08c67f2033ea80dcf712b47ed4e970c75fc614
spent
true